Программно-определяемый центр обработки данных
![]() | В этой статье есть несколько проблем. Пожалуйста, помогите улучшить его или обсудите эти проблемы на странице обсуждения . ( Узнайте, как и когда удалять эти шаблонные сообщения )
|
Программно-определяемый центр обработки данных ( SDDC ; также: виртуальный центр обработки данных, VDC) — это маркетинговый термин, который расширяет концепции виртуализации, такие как абстракция, объединение в пулы и автоматизация, на все ресурсы и услуги центра обработки данных для достижения ИТ как услуги (ITaaS). [1] В программно-определяемом центре обработки данных «все элементы инфраструктуры — сеть, хранилище, ЦП и безопасность — виртуализируются и предоставляются как услуга». [2]
Поддержка SDDC может быть востребована с помощью самых разных подходов. Критики рассматривают программно-определяемые центры обработки данных как маркетинговый инструмент и «программно-определяемую шумиху», отмечая эту изменчивость. [3]
В 2013 году аналитики были разделены на три разные группы: [3] те, кто думает, что это «просто еще одна рекламная шумиха, определяемая программным обеспечением», те, кто думает, что большинство компонентов уже доступны, и те, кто видит потенциальный рынок будущего. Единого соглашения о направлении SDDC не было. некоторых областей, таких как программно-определяемые сети, к 2016 году составит около 3,7 млрд долларов США по сравнению с 360 млн долларов США в 2013 году. Ожидалось, что рыночная стоимость [3] (Ожидается, что в 2022 году объем программно-определяемых сетей достигнет 18,5 миллиардов долларов США. [4] , IDC По оценкам рынок программно-определяемых систем хранения данных будет расширяться быстрее, чем любой другой рынок систем хранения данных. [3]
Описание и основные компоненты
[ редактировать ]Программно-определяемый центр обработки данных включает в себя множество концепций и компонентов инфраструктуры центра обработки данных, причем каждый компонент потенциально предоставляется , эксплуатируется и управляется через интерфейс прикладного программирования (API). [5] Основные архитектурные компоненты, составляющие программно-определяемый центр обработки данных. [6] включают следующее:
- компьютерная виртуализация , [7] - программная реализация компьютера
- программно-определяемая сеть (SDN), включающая виртуализацию сети — процесс объединения аппаратных и программных ресурсов и сетевых функций в программную виртуальную сеть. [6]
- Программно-определяемое хранилище (SDS), которое включает в себя виртуализацию хранилища , предлагает сервисный интерфейс для предоставления емкости и SLA (соглашения об уровне обслуживания) для хранилища, включая производительность и надежность.
- программное обеспечение для управления и автоматизации, позволяющее администратору предоставлять, контролировать и управлять всеми программно-определяемыми компонентами центра обработки данных. [8]
Программно-определяемый центр обработки данных отличается от частного облака , поскольку частное облако должно предлагать только виртуальных машин . самообслуживание [9] при котором он мог бы использовать традиционное обеспечение и управление. Вместо этого концепции SDDC представляют собой центр обработки данных, который может включать в себя частные, общедоступные и гибридные облака. [10]
Истоки и развитие
[ редактировать ]Центрам обработки данных традиционно не хватало мощности для тотальной виртуализации. [11] К 2013 году компании начали закладывать основу для программно-определяемых центров обработки данных с виртуализацией. [3] Бен Чериан из Midokura считал веб-сервисы Amazon катализатором перехода к программно-конфигурируемым центрам обработки данных, поскольку они «убедили мир в том, что центр обработки данных можно разделить на гораздо более мелкие единицы и рассматривать как одноразовые технологии, которые, в свою очередь, могут быть оценены как коммунальные услуги». [5]
Потенциальное воздействие
[ редактировать ]В 2013 году термин «программно-определяемый центр обработки данных» был представлен как сдвиг парадигмы. [5] [12] По словам Стива Херрода, программно-определяемый центр обработки данных обещает, что компаниям больше не придется полагаться на специализированное оборудование или нанимать консультантов для установки и программирования оборудования на его специализированном языке. [13] Скорее, ИТ-отдел будет определять приложения и все необходимые им ресурсы, включая вычисления, хранилище, сеть, безопасность и доступность, и группировать все необходимые компоненты для создания «логического приложения». [13]
Часто упоминаемые преимущества программно-определяемых центров обработки данных включают повышение эффективности. [14] от распространения виртуализации по всему центру обработки данных; повышенная ловкость [15] от быстрой подготовки приложений; улучшенный контроль [15] над доступностью и безопасностью приложений посредством управления на основе политик; и гибкость [14] [15] запускать новые и существующие приложения на нескольких платформах и облаках.
Кроме того, реализация программно-определяемого центра обработки данных может снизить потребление энергии компанией, позволяя серверам и другому оборудованию центра обработки данных работать на пониженном уровне мощности или отключаться. [15] Некоторые считают, что программно-определяемые центры обработки данных повышают безопасность, предоставляя организациям больший контроль над размещенными ими данными и уровнями безопасности по сравнению с безопасностью, обеспечиваемой поставщиками размещенных облаков. [15]
Программно-определяемый центр обработки данных был продан с целью снизить цены на оборудование для центров обработки данных и бросить вызов традиционным поставщикам оборудования разработать новые способы дифференциации своих продуктов с помощью программного обеспечения и услуг. [16]
Проблемы
[ редактировать ]Концепции программно-определяемых центров обработки данных в целом и программно-определяемых центров обработки данных в частности были отвергнуты некоторыми как «нонсенс», « рыночная структура » и «программно-определяемая шумиха». [3] Некоторые критики полагают, что лишь меньшинство компаний с уже существующими «полностью однородными ИТ-системами», например Yahoo! и Google могут перейти на программно-определяемые центры обработки данных. [3]
По мнению некоторых наблюдателей, программно-определяемые центры обработки данных не обязательно устранят проблемы, связанные с преодолением различий между средами разработки и производства; управление сочетанием устаревших и новых приложений; или предоставление соглашений об уровне обслуживания (SLA). [3]
Программно-определяемые сети рассматривались как неотъемлемая часть программно-определяемого центра обработки данных, но они также считаются «наименее зрелой технологией», необходимой для работы программно-определяемого центра обработки данных. [11] Однако несколько компаний, в том числе Arista Networks , Cisco , Microsoft и VMware , продают продукты, позволяющие создавать, расширять и перемещать виртуальные сети через существующие физические сети. [11]
К 2012 году уже существовало несколько конкурирующих стандартов виртуализации сети. [11] Neutron, сетевой компонент программного обеспечения с открытым исходным кодом проекта OpenStack , обеспечивает абстракцию сетевых ресурсов на уровне приложения и включает интерфейс для настройки виртуальных коммутаторов. [11] [17]
Подход к программно-определяемым центрам обработки данных заставит ИТ-организации адаптироваться. Программно-определяемые среды требуют переосмысления многих ИТ-процессов, включая автоматизацию, измерение и выставление счетов, а также выполнения предоставления услуг, активации услуг и обеспечения качества обслуживания. [15] Широкомасштабный переход к SDDC может занять годы. [6]
Ссылки
[ редактировать ]- ^ Дэвидсон, Эмили А. «Программно-определяемый центр обработки данных (SDDC): концепция или реальность? [VMware]» . Советник Softchoice Статья . Советник Softchoice. Архивировано из оригинала 14 августа 2013 года . Проверено 28 июня 2013 г.
- ^ Роуз, Маргарет. «Определение: программно-конфигурируемый центр обработки данных» . Архивировано из оригинала 5 августа 2016 года . Проверено 25 февраля 2014 г.
- ^ Jump up to: а б с д и ж г час Ковар, Джозеф Ф. (13 мая 2013 г.). «Программно-определяемые центры обработки данных: стоит ли вам присоединиться к этому тренду?» . КРН . Проверено 10 февраля 2014 г.
- ^ Рынки, исследования и (27 февраля 2023 г.). «Глобальный рынок программно-определяемых сетей достигнет 75,6 миллиардов долларов к 2030 году: рост внедрения BYOD будет способствовать устойчивому росту рынка SDN» . Отдел новостей GlobeNewswire (пресс-релиз) . Проверено 2 мая 2023 г.
- ^ Jump up to: а б с Чериан, Бен. «Что такое программно-конфигурируемый центр обработки данных и почему это важно?» . Все вещи D пост . Все вещи Д. Проверено 28 июня 2013 г.
- ^ Jump up to: а б с Волк, Торстен. «Программно-определяемый центр обработки данных: Часть 2 из 4 – Основные компоненты» . Блоги EMA . ЭМА . Проверено 28 июня 2013 г.
- ^ «Программно-определяемый центр обработки данных — часть 2: вычисления» . Сообщение в блоге CohesiveFT . Блог CohesiveFT . Проверено 28 июня 2013 г.
- ^ Маршалл, Дэвид (18 марта 2013 г.). «Программно-определяемый центр обработки данных VMware будет включать виртуализацию сети NSX» . Статья InfoWorld . Инфомир . Проверено 28 июня 2013 г.
- ^ Донахолл, Стефани (10 мая 2019 г.). «Три способа внедрения программно-конфигурируемого центра обработки данных» . Колокейшн Америка . Проверено 15 сентября 2021 г.
- ^ Оти, Майкл (29 мая 2013 г.). «Движение к программно-конфигурируемому центру обработки данных» . ИТ-профессионал . Архивировано из оригинала 5 сентября 2017 года . Проверено 28 июня 2013 г.
- ^ Jump up to: а б с д и Норр, Эрик (13 августа 2012 г.). «Что на самом деле означает программно-определяемый центр обработки данных» . Инфомир . Проверено 28 июня 2013 г.
- ^ Пол Шред (25 июля 2013 г.). «Программно-определяемые центры обработки данных могут изменить ИТ-ландшафт» . Датаматизация . Проверено 22 августа 2016 г.
- ^ Jump up to: а б Херрод, Стив. «Взаимодействие и программно-определяемый центр обработки данных» . Сообщение в блоге VMware . ВМваре . Проверено 28 июня 2013 г.
- ^ Jump up to: а б Эрлс, Алан. «Готов ли программно-определяемый центр обработки данных к массовому использованию?» . Статья SearchDataCenter . Центр данных поиска. Архивировано из оригинала 9 июля 2018 года . Проверено 28 июня 2013 г.
- ^ Jump up to: а б с д и ж Венкатраман, Арчана. «Программно-определяемые центры обработки данных раскрыты» . ComputerWeekly.com . Проверено 28 июня 2013 г.
- ^ Манка, Пит (29 мая 2013 г.). «Программно-определяемые центры обработки данных: о чем идет речь?» . Проводной . Проверено 28 июня 2013 г.
- ^ «Документация разработчика Neutron» . ОпенСтек . Проверено 22 августа 2016 г.
Внешние ссылки
[ редактировать ]- Программно-определяемые облачные вычисления: архитектурные элементы и открытые проблемы
- Программно-конфигурируемые центры обработки данных: о чем идет речь?
- Что такое программно-конфигурируемый центр обработки данных и почему это важно?
- Что на самом деле означает программно-определяемый центр обработки данных
- Что такое программно-определяемый центр обработки данных и как он может помочь вашему бизнесу?